    Deaths matter. Battlefield Rush and Conquest modes are not a lone wolf affairs. Every time you die it ticks away at your team counter and when that counter hits zero its game over. Don't be stupid and waste life after life running into the same gauntlet of enemy fire. You don't have to hide in a ditch the entire game, just play smart like your life matters because in this game it does.

    The only time deaths do not matter is if you are the defending team on Rush. You have unlimited lives so go at the enemy hard because the attacking team does have limited lives.

    If the attackers do manage to capture a base don't be afraid to let them kill you so you can quickly respawn at the forward base.

    Always join a squad and spawn on your squad to get closer to the action quicker. Two, three and four players work better in this game. Conversely, if you are alone and see all your squad is dead hold up for a few seconds in a safe area and allow them to spawn on you. You will be rewarded for it.

    Cycle through and watch the camera to make sure it is safe to spawn.

    As said by many always be spotting, Capturing. Healing. Resupplying. Repairing. You gain points for all of this.

    mines > vehicles and often overlooked by inexperienced drivers. Great way to rack up quick multiple kills.

    gravity exist in this game. bullets drop. aim high.

    the best way to avoid being shot from cover is to blow up cover

    don't abandon vehicles - damaged or otherwise. since engineers can repair stuff leaving a smoking tank is like gifting the enemy a new tank. you should leave a vehicle only when it blows up.

    - ALWAYS be in a squad. They act as mobile spawn locations and you get bonus points for interacting with them (Giving ammo, healing, etc).
     
    - Keep an eye on the location of your squad mates, if you are deep in enemy territory, sometimes its better to wait a few seconds so your squad can spawn on you before you rush in and get picked off. Going from 1 man behind enemy lines to 4 can be a huge deal. 
     
    - If you are in a shootout with somebody and you run out of ammo in your clip, switch to your pistol and finish him off. Using your pistol is always better than trying to reload in front of an enemy.
     
    - When you equip a Tactical Light or Laser Sight, remember that they produce light or a laser off your weapon constantly, this makes you an easy target in the wrong situations. Turn it on and off using the Dpad!   ALSO: That tactical light is very bright, don't aim at teammates because its blinding them and being very annoying. Try to get into the habit of toggling it and being respectful to your team.
     
    - Don't be afraid to switch classes if there is a pesky tank that nobody seems to be dealing with. You might not be as good or like the engineer class as much as your favourite, but taking that tank out is going to get you a ton of points and help out the team. Plus you are leveling up another class and making yourself a better, more well rounded player and teammate.

    my tips:

    Always aim at the back of a tank with a rocket. This will disable it in one shot. Rockets also do more damage from the side and back.

    If you don't want to repair, at least put down mines. Mines will net you easy points and a easy way to defend objectives from pesky tanks. Also use them on intersections and high traffic areas.

    If you are trying to take down an airplane, have a buddy AA with you. One rocket will get deflected but the second one will almost always hit. TEAMWORK!

    Tanks are bad at maneuvering, so don't drive them to places where they will be slowed down or tight corners. Use your tank to take objectives on the outside, i.e. Caspian Boarder, objectives A, B, and E. Your tank will reach these points faster, while your infantry can focus on C and D.

    Even if your aim sucks (like mine), lay down suppressive fire. Its the best feature in this game and use it well. Accuracy can suck it.

    Its best to move in a group, strength in numbers.

    Fill in roles that are needed. A squad of all Engineers? Switch to Support to give them more rockets!

    Always be spotting!

    Recon:

    Consider the map when choosing accessories for your sniper rifle. Large, open map? Go with the ballistic (x12) scope if you have it. Small, close-quarters maps, consider using less than x7 scopes - you'll avoid giving off the "scope glint" - also consider using the tac light if you want to get up closer to front lines.

    Re: "scope glint", any scope x7 or higher gives it off when you actively sight. Its directional, so don't scan one area too long, or risk tipping off enemies.

    When using x7 of higher scopes, you can hold your breath to steady aim by holding "SHIFT".

    Use the "T-UGS" prox-detector offensively - you get an added bonus for killing enemies detected by this unlock. Drop it where you think the enemy will be, move far away (you get distance bonus on headshots) and rack up bonus xp.
